The NTN Spherical Roller Bearing represents a pinnacle of engineering, meticulously designed for enhanced reliability and performance. With its robust construction and precision engineering, this product excels in demanding applications, ensuring seamless operation even under heavy loads. Ideal for diverse industrial sectors, its pressed steel cage reinforces the integrity, while the carefully defined radial clearance class optimises performance. Operating efficiently within temperature ranges of -40 °C to 200 °C, it adapts to varying conditions effortlessly. Additionally, its compatibility with high-speed applications makes it a versatile choice for both manufacturers and engineers alike. Whether you require a replacement or are looking to outfit a new project, this bearing stands as a testament to quality and durability, derived from decades of expertise.
